Android Open Source - App control Android-NetPowerctrl






Project Summary

Smart Power Control is an Android App for controlling switchable outlets like the ANEL NET-series (www.anel-elektronik.de).

Web Site / Source Repository

Android-NetPowerctrl is hosted in the following web site
https://github.com/davidgraeff/Android-NetPowerctrl

If you think the Android project Android-NetPowerctrl listed in this page is inappropriate, such as containing malicious code/tools or violating the copyright, please email info at java2s dot com, thanks.

Project Detail

The following table is the detailed list of Android-NetPowerctrl.

ItemValue
Java File Count195
Supported screen sizes[mdpi, ldpi, xxhdpi, hdpi, xhdpi, nodpi]
Activity Count5
Fragment Count13
Required Permissionsandroid.permission.ACCESS_NETWORK_STATE
android.permission.ACCESS_WIFI_STATE
android.permission.INTERNET
android.permission.MANAGE_DOCUMENTS
android.permission.NFC
android.permission.READ_EXTERNAL_STORAGE
android.permission.RECEIVE_BOOT_COMPLETED
android.permission.WAKE_LOCK
com.android.launcher.permission.INSTALL_SHORTCUT
com.android.vending.BILLING
oly.netpowerctrl.permission.PLUGINS
Asset File Namesassets\widget_icons\off_circle.png
assets\widget_icons\off_default.png
assets\widget_icons\off_flat.png
assets\widget_icons\off_power.png
assets\widget_icons\on_circle.png
assets\widget_icons\on_default.png
assets\widget_icons\on_flat.png
assets\widget_icons\on_power.png
assets\widget_icons\unknown_circle.png
assets\widget_icons\unknown_circle2.png
assets\widget_icons\unknown_default.png
assets\widget_icons\unknown_flat.png
assets\widget_icons\unknown_power.png
Raw File Namesres\raw\changelog.xml




License

The license information of Android-NetPowerctrl is as follows:

GNU General Public License

Resource Files

There are 45 image files in Android-NetPowerctrl. The names of the image files are listed as follows.

card_dark.9.png
card_highlighted.9.png
card_light.9.png
ic_action_download.png
ic_action_download_light.png
ic_action_flash_off.png
ic_action_flash_off_light.png
ic_action_flash_on.png
ic_action_flash_on_light.png
ic_action_shuffle.png
ic_action_shuffle_light.png
ic_action_view_as_grid.png
ic_action_view_as_grid_dark.png
ic_action_view_as_list.png
ic_action_view_as_list_dark.png
ic_menu_close_clear_cancel.png
ic_menu_delete.png
ic_menu_edit.png
ic_menu_refresh.png
netpowerctrl.png
segment_grey.9.png
segment_grey_focus.9.png
segment_grey_press.9.png
segment_radio_grey_left.9.png
segment_radio_grey_left_focus.9.png
segment_radio_grey_left_press.9.png
segment_radio_grey_middle.9.png
segment_radio_grey_middle_focus.9.png
segment_radio_grey_middle_press.9.png
segment_radio_grey_right.9.png
segment_radio_grey_right_focus.9.png
segment_radio_grey_right_press.9.png
segment_radio_white_left.9.png
segment_radio_white_left_focus.9.png
segment_radio_white_left_press.9.png
segment_radio_white_middle.9.png
segment_radio_white_middle_focus.9.png
segment_radio_white_middle_press.9.png
segment_radio_white_right.9.png
segment_radio_white_right_focus.9.png
segment_radio_white_right_press.9.png
segment_white.9.png
segment_white_focus.9.png
tag.png
title_header.png

The following screenshort is generated from the image listed above.

null




Java Source Files

Android-NetPowerctrl has the following Java source files.

com.jeremyfeinstein.slidingmenu.lib.CanvasTransformerBuilder.java
com.jeremyfeinstein.slidingmenu.lib.app.SlidingActivity.java
com.jeremyfeinstein.slidingmenu.lib.app.SlidingActivityBase.java
com.jeremyfeinstein.slidingmenu.lib.app.SlidingActivityHelper.java
com.jeremyfeinstein.slidingmenu.lib.app.SlidingFragmentActivity.java
com.jeremyfeinstein.slidingmenu.lib.app.SlidingListActivity.java
com.jeremyfeinstein.slidingmenu.lib.app.SlidingPreferenceActivity.java
oly.netpowerctrl.anel.AnelAlarm.java
oly.netpowerctrl.anel.AnelBroadcastSendJob.java
oly.netpowerctrl.anel.AnelEditDevice.java
oly.netpowerctrl.anel.AnelHttpReceiveSend.java
oly.netpowerctrl.anel.AnelPlugin.java
oly.netpowerctrl.anel.AnelTimer.java
oly.netpowerctrl.backup.drive.BackupDoneSuccess.java
oly.netpowerctrl.backup.drive.BackupDoneSuccess.java
oly.netpowerctrl.backup.drive.DoneSuccess.java
oly.netpowerctrl.backup.drive.GDrive.java
oly.netpowerctrl.backup.drive.GDriveFragment.java
oly.netpowerctrl.backup.neighbours.NeighbourAdapter.java
oly.netpowerctrl.backup.neighbours.NeighbourDataReceiveService.java
oly.netpowerctrl.backup.neighbours.NeighbourDataSync.java
oly.netpowerctrl.backup.neighbours.NeighbourDiscoverReceiving.java
oly.netpowerctrl.backup.neighbours.NeighbourFragment.java
oly.netpowerctrl.data.AppData.java
oly.netpowerctrl.data.CollectionWithStorableItems.java
oly.netpowerctrl.data.CollectionWithType.java
oly.netpowerctrl.data.DataLoadedObserver.java
oly.netpowerctrl.data.DataQueryCompletedObserver.java
oly.netpowerctrl.data.DataQueryRefreshObserver.java
oly.netpowerctrl.data.FavCollection.java
oly.netpowerctrl.data.IconCacheCleared.java
oly.netpowerctrl.data.IconCacheClearedObserver.java
oly.netpowerctrl.data.IconDeferredLoadingThread.java
oly.netpowerctrl.data.ImportExport.java
oly.netpowerctrl.data.LoadStoreIconData.java
oly.netpowerctrl.data.LoadStoreJSonData.java
oly.netpowerctrl.data.SharedPrefs.java
oly.netpowerctrl.data.WakeUpDeviceInterface.java
oly.netpowerctrl.data.onCollectionUpdated.java
oly.netpowerctrl.data.onDataLoaded.java
oly.netpowerctrl.data.onDataQueryCompleted.java
oly.netpowerctrl.data.onDataQueryRefreshQuery.java
oly.netpowerctrl.data.onStorageUpdate.java
oly.netpowerctrl.data.static.java
oly.netpowerctrl.devices.DeviceCollection.java
oly.netpowerctrl.devices.DeviceConnectionPreferences.java
oly.netpowerctrl.devices.DeviceEditDialog.java
oly.netpowerctrl.devices.DeviceEditNewHttpDialog.java
oly.netpowerctrl.devices.DeviceItemsDialog.java
oly.netpowerctrl.devices.DeviceShareDialog.java
oly.netpowerctrl.devices.DevicesAdapter.java
oly.netpowerctrl.devices.DevicesFragment.java
oly.netpowerctrl.devices.DevicesWizardNewDialog.java
oly.netpowerctrl.devices.EditDeviceInterface.java
oly.netpowerctrl.devices.UnconfiguredDeviceCollection.java
oly.netpowerctrl.devices.onCreateDeviceResult.java
oly.netpowerctrl.executables.AdapterSource.java
oly.netpowerctrl.executables.AdapterSourceFilter.java
oly.netpowerctrl.executables.AdapterSourceInput.java
oly.netpowerctrl.executables.AdapterSourceInputDemo.java
oly.netpowerctrl.executables.AdapterSourceInputDevicePorts.java
oly.netpowerctrl.executables.AdapterSourceInputGroups.java
oly.netpowerctrl.executables.AdapterSourceInputOneDevicePorts.java
oly.netpowerctrl.executables.AdapterSourceInputScenes.java
oly.netpowerctrl.executables.ExecutableAdapterItem.java
oly.netpowerctrl.executables.ExecutableViewHolder.java
oly.netpowerctrl.executables.ExecutablesAdapter.java
oly.netpowerctrl.executables.ExecutablesCheckableAdapter.java
oly.netpowerctrl.executables.ExecutablesEditableAdapter.java
oly.netpowerctrl.executables.FilterByReachable.java
oly.netpowerctrl.executables.FilterBySingleGroup.java
oly.netpowerctrl.groups.Group.java
oly.netpowerctrl.groups.GroupAdapter.java
oly.netpowerctrl.groups.GroupCollection.java
oly.netpowerctrl.groups.GroupUtilities.java
oly.netpowerctrl.groups.GroupsAdapter.java
oly.netpowerctrl.main.App.java
oly.netpowerctrl.main.EditActivity.java
oly.netpowerctrl.main.ExecutionActivity.java
oly.netpowerctrl.main.FeedbackFragment.java
oly.netpowerctrl.main.IntroductionFragment.java
oly.netpowerctrl.main.LifecycleHandler.java
oly.netpowerctrl.main.MainActivity.java
oly.netpowerctrl.main.NfcTagWriterActivity.java
oly.netpowerctrl.main.OutletsFragment.java
oly.netpowerctrl.main.OutletsViewModeDialog.java
oly.netpowerctrl.network.HttpThreadPool.java
oly.netpowerctrl.network.SendAndObserve.java
oly.netpowerctrl.network.Subnet.java
oly.netpowerctrl.network.UDPErrors.java
oly.netpowerctrl.network.UDPReceiving.java
oly.netpowerctrl.network.Utils.java
oly.netpowerctrl.network.onDeviceObserverFinishedResult.java
oly.netpowerctrl.network.onDeviceObserverResult.java
oly.netpowerctrl.network.onExecutionFinished.java
oly.netpowerctrl.network.onHttpRequestResult.java
oly.netpowerctrl.network.onNotReachableUpdate.java
oly.netpowerctrl.outletsview.MasterSlaveFragment.java
oly.netpowerctrl.pluginservice.AbstractBasePlugin.java
oly.netpowerctrl.pluginservice.DeviceObserverBase.java
oly.netpowerctrl.pluginservice.DeviceQuery.java
oly.netpowerctrl.pluginservice.PluginRemote.java
oly.netpowerctrl.pluginservice.PluginService.java
oly.netpowerctrl.pluginservice.ServiceModeChangedObserver.java
oly.netpowerctrl.pluginservice.ServiceReadyObserver.java
oly.netpowerctrl.pluginservice.onPluginFinished.java
oly.netpowerctrl.pluginservice.onPluginReady.java
oly.netpowerctrl.pluginservice.onPluginsReady.java
oly.netpowerctrl.pluginservice.onServiceModeChanged.java
oly.netpowerctrl.pluginservice.onServiceReady.java
oly.netpowerctrl.preferences.DatePreference.java
oly.netpowerctrl.preferences.LogFragment.java
oly.netpowerctrl.preferences.PreferencesFragment.java
oly.netpowerctrl.preferences.PreferencesWithValuesFragment.java
oly.netpowerctrl.preferences.TimePreference.java
oly.netpowerctrl.preferences.WidgetPreferenceFragment.java
oly.netpowerctrl.scenes.Scene.java
oly.netpowerctrl.scenes.SceneCollection.java
oly.netpowerctrl.scenes.SceneElementsAdapter.java
oly.netpowerctrl.scenes.SceneElementsAssigning.java
oly.netpowerctrl.scenes.SceneElementsInFlowLayout.java
oly.netpowerctrl.scenes.SceneFactory.java
oly.netpowerctrl.scenes.SceneItem.java
oly.netpowerctrl.scenes.ScenesAdapter.java
oly.netpowerctrl.scenes.ScenesFragment.java
oly.netpowerctrl.timer.AlarmOnDevice.java
oly.netpowerctrl.timer.BootCompletedReceiver.java
oly.netpowerctrl.timer.Timer.java
oly.netpowerctrl.timer.TimerAdapter.java
oly.netpowerctrl.timer.TimerCollection.java
oly.netpowerctrl.timer.TimerEditFragmentDialog.java
oly.netpowerctrl.timer.TimerFragment.java
oly.netpowerctrl.ui.ChangeLogUtil.java
oly.netpowerctrl.ui.CustomDatePicker.java
oly.netpowerctrl.ui.CustomTimePicker.java
oly.netpowerctrl.ui.RecyclerItemClickListener.java
oly.netpowerctrl.ui.RecyclerViewAdapterFragment.java
oly.netpowerctrl.ui.RecyclerViewWithAdapter.java
oly.netpowerctrl.ui.SoftRadioButton.java
oly.netpowerctrl.ui.SoftRadioGroup.java
oly.netpowerctrl.ui.SwipeMoveAnimator.java
oly.netpowerctrl.ui.TouchEffectAnimator.java
oly.netpowerctrl.ui.navigation.DrawerAdapter.java
oly.netpowerctrl.ui.navigation.NavigationController.java
oly.netpowerctrl.ui.notifications.ChangeLogNotification.java
oly.netpowerctrl.ui.notifications.InAppNotifications.java
oly.netpowerctrl.ui.notifications.PermanentNotification.java
oly.netpowerctrl.ui.notifications.TextNotification.java
oly.netpowerctrl.ui.widgets.EnhancedSwipeRefreshLayout.java
oly.netpowerctrl.ui.widgets.FloatingActionButton.java
oly.netpowerctrl.ui.widgets.RelativeLayoutRipple.java
oly.netpowerctrl.ui.widgets.SegmentedRadioGroup.java
oly.netpowerctrl.ui.widgets.SlidingTabLayout.java
oly.netpowerctrl.utils.ActionBarTitle.java
oly.netpowerctrl.utils.AndroidShortcuts.java
oly.netpowerctrl.utils.AnimationController.java
oly.netpowerctrl.utils.AssetContentProvider.java
oly.netpowerctrl.utils.AssetDocumentProvider.java
oly.netpowerctrl.utils.DividerItemDecoration.java
oly.netpowerctrl.utils.Donate.java
oly.netpowerctrl.utils.DonateData.java
oly.netpowerctrl.utils.GithubAndCloudant.java
oly.netpowerctrl.utils.Logging.java
oly.netpowerctrl.utils.MutableBoolean.java
oly.netpowerctrl.utils.Observer.java
oly.netpowerctrl.utils.SortCriteriaDialog.java
oly.netpowerctrl.utils.SortCriteriaInterface.java
oly.netpowerctrl.utils.SortCustomDialog.java
oly.netpowerctrl.utils.Sorting.java
oly.netpowerctrl.utils.Streams.java
oly.netpowerctrl.utils.WakeLocker.java
oly.netpowerctrl.utils.fragments.onFragmentBackButton.java
oly.netpowerctrl.utils.statusbar_and_speech.AndroidStatusBarService.java
oly.netpowerctrl.utils.statusbar_and_speech.SpeechHotwordDetector.java
oly.netpowerctrl.widget.DeviceWidgetProvider.java
oly.netpowerctrl.widget.WidgetConfigActivity.java
oly.netpowerctrl.widget.WidgetConfigFragment.java
oly.netpowerctrl.widget.WidgetUpdateService.java
org.sufficientlysecure.donations.DonationsFragment.java
org.sufficientlysecure.donations.google.util.IabException.java
org.sufficientlysecure.donations.google.util.IabHelper.java
org.sufficientlysecure.donations.google.util.IabResult.java
org.sufficientlysecure.donations.google.util.Inventory.java
org.sufficientlysecure.donations.google.util.Purchase.java
org.sufficientlysecure.donations.google.util.Security.java
org.sufficientlysecure.donations.google.util.SkuDetails.java